API 참조

등록 관리에 설명된 대로 Notification Hubs를 사용하는 애플리케이션은 모바일 애플리케이션과 앱 백 엔드 모두에서 허브에 액세스하도록 선택할 수 있습니다.

이러한 두 액세스 패턴을 보다 효율적으로 처리하기 위해 알림 허브는 두 가지 API 집합을 제공합니다. 그 중 하나는 모바일 앱에서 알림을 등록하는 데 사용되고, 다른 하나는 앱 백 엔드에서 등록 관리를 수행하고 알림을 보내는 데 사용됩니다. 또한 알림 허브에는 백 엔드 API를 통해 노출되는 모든 기능을 포함하는 REST API 계층이 표시됩니다.

장치 API

장치 API는 모바일 앱에서 장치를 등록할 때만 사용되며 보안상의 이유로 Send 메서드는 표시하지 않습니다. 이러한 API는 장치 로컬 저장소에서 알림 허브 관련 정보 관리를 자동화하며 단일 PNS 등록을 지원합니다. 예를 들어 Windows 스토어 장치 API는 Windows 장치만 등록합니다.

현재 알림 허브에서 제공하는 장치 API 집합은 다음과 같습니다.

백 엔드 API

백 엔드 API는 모든 플랫폼에 대해 백 엔드에서 등록을 관리하고 알림을 보내는 데 사용됩니다.

현재 알림 허브에서 제공하는 백 엔드 API 집합은 다음과 같습니다.

REST API

모든 Notification Hubs 기능은 REST API를 통해 제공됩니다. 자세한 내용은 Notification Hubs REST API를 참조하세요.